Hillary Scott is a member of the country music band Lady Antebellum. A Nashville-native, Hillary is the daughter of Grammy Award-winning country artist Linda Davis and accomplished musician Lang Scott, which helped her develop her passion for music at an early age. After Lady Antebellum hit the music scene in 2006, the trio earned “Top New Group” honors at the 2008 Academy of Country Music (ACM) Awards, the 2008 Country Music Association (CMA) Awards and two GRAMMY nominations for the 51st Annual GRAMMY Awards.

My band — Lady Antebellum — is doing something different this year. We want to practice realistic green habits that we know we can do year-round, not just on Earth Day.

We just released our latest video for a song called “I Run to You,” which is all about paying it forward. The idea of making small lifestyle changes now as a way to “pay it forward” so future generations have a better planet is such a simple and obvious way we can help.

One of our first steps was taking the FilterForGood pledge to reduce bottled water waste. Like a lot of people, we drink a ton of bottled water, especially when we’re on the road. We can go through dozens of bottles every day between our band and crew.

All that plastic can really pile up, and it’s not always easy to recycle, especially when we’re traveling around in a bus and in a different city every day. When we can, we’re going to do the filtered water thing. It’s a small, simple change that can go a long way. It’s not a hard change to make, and it’s something our fans can do, too.
